- General note - Because of the Manila City Hall's proximity to Intramuros, Japanese hold-outs defended it to the last man. The building became General Mac-Arthur's headquarters and command post on February 23, 1945. On the left is Arroceros Street; farther ahead is the smoke stack of the Insular Ice Plant.
